Contact seller5-star sellerHC. 512pp First published in 1868 under the title INCIDENTS AMONG SHOT AND SHELL, and reissued a year later under this more "peaceful title." "The only authentic work extant giving the many tragic and touching incidents that came under the notice of the United States Christian Commission during the long years of the Civil War."…Nevins, CIVIL WAR BOOKS: A CRITICAL BIBLIOGRAPHY, Volume II, Page 135. An interesting collection of soldier's anecdotal accounts throughout the war as gathered by the commission. The binding is loose, but still attached, with well worn bumped corners. The interior pages are clean and unmarked, as are the pale green and white end papers. The author Rev. Edward Parmelee Smith (1827-1876) was a Congregational minister in Massachusetts before becoming Field Secretary for the United States Christian Commission during the American Civil War. A letter from Reverend Edward Parmlee Smith (18271876), then a field secretary of the American Missionary Association, requesting a free or half-priced Singer sewing machine for the "colored young men & women" who are "working their way through an education" at Howard University. The AMA was initially forme…d as an abolitionist society; following the Civil War, it funded churches and schools for freed African Americans. One such school is Howard University in Washington, D.C., founded in 1867. Smith himself co-founded Fisk University in Nashville. Following Smith's tenure at the AMA, he would be appointed Commissioner of Indian Affairs, and later elected president of Howard. Besides the Freedmen's Bureau, funding for HBCUs at the time largely came from donations, both from individual philanthropists and through organizations like the AMA. However, precedent for direct donations of equipment is less clear, nor is it known whether Singer honored Parmlee's request. Single one-page letter measuring 8 x 9 ¾ inches.
